Abstract

método e aparelho para coexistência de múltiplos rádios em bandas de frequência adjacentes um método e um aparelho para um coprogramador poder mitigar interferência de banda de frequência de portadora adjacente ue-para-ue por alocar três conjuntos de um enlace ascendente de primeiro equipamento de usuário. cada conjunto tem pelo menos uma subportadora em uma primeira banda de frequência, pelo menos um período de tempo de enlace ascendente, e pelo menos um parâmetro de potência de transmissão. o coprogramador inicialmente aloca o primeiro conjunto. o coprogramador aloca o segundo conjunto em resposta à detectar um segundo equipamento de usuário operando próximo ao primeiro equipamento de usuário, e o segundo conjunto é diferente do primeiro conjunto quer em pelo menos uma subportadora ou pelo menos um parâmetro de potência de transmissão. o coprogramador aloca o terceiro conjunto em resposta à detecção de que o segundo equipamento de usuário não está mais operando próximo ao primeiro equipamento de usuário, e o terceiro conjunto difere do segundo conjunto pelo menos em qualquer uma subportadora ou pelo menos um parâmetro de potência de transmissão. vários métodos para controlar um equipamento de usuário agressor (ue) podem usar dois loops de controle de potência de transmissão para mitigar interferência de banda de frequência de portadora adjacente ue-para-ue para um ue vítima geograficamente próximo. o ue agressor pode selecionar entre diferentes parâmetros de potência de transmissão com base em dois (ou mais) valores de potência. o uso de qualquer valor de potência particular depende do período de tempo da transmissão. por exemplo, se um ue vítima próximo é programado para receber quando o ue agressor é programado para transmitir, um valor de potência inferior pode ser selecionado como instruído por um coprogramador ou determinado pelo ue agressor. o ue agressor também pode enviar relatórios de sobra de potência duplos para sua estação base servindo com base nos dois valores de potência.
